i have an F-20 parts tractor with 4th gear toward fuel tank (cast shift pattern) it is a 1938 with 36 inch round spoke wheels.
my other 20's have 4th gear toward rear of tractor.
is this a "road gear" and what is approximate speed?

My parts book lists that option as the 7.07 MPH gear. Still not as fast as the external road box, which could be between 15-19 MPH. I have an F-20 with the high speed 4th, and plan to put a road box on it for comparison. With the selections of speeds, it should make a good parade tractor.

Yes, this is a factory road gear option. It actually is a 5th gear (although slower that 5th in a H or M). They kept the old 4th gear and renumbered it as 3rd.
